Output 3039514b5edc4c796ca8b76852062cd2368b7bc74b2ab56ca8ed1792b5797529:0

value
43418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ab285d4cae0411c1f2613e5aa8a4becbcf0e058 OP_EQUAL
address
3BRBQri7J72Jo597QQddCVvW9wKjHdyMj3
transaction
3039514b5edc4c796ca8b76852062cd2368b7bc74b2ab56ca8ed1792b5797529
confirmations
66487
spent
true